In response, we are developing an innovative authentication system based on eye movement patterns. This non-invasive biometric approach offers a higher level of security by leveraging the unique and complex patterns of an individual's eye movements, making unauthorized access significantly more challenging.

Our eye tracking system incorporates advanced, customizable gaze gesture techniques, marking advancement in security measures. It will directly tackle the vulnerabilities inherent in facial unlocking mechanisms, providing a robust solution to evolving digital threats.</ns2:abstractText></ns2:project>
